Flights from Rochester to Myrtle Beach - Travel Insights & Trends

Get data-powered insights and trends into flights from Rochester to Myrtle Beach to help you find the cheapest flights, the best time to fly and much more.

What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Rochester to Myrtle Beach?

The average price of all flights from Rochester to Myrtle Beach cl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.
When flying from Rochester to Myrtle Beach, you should consider leaving on a Monday and avoid Thursdays if you are looking for the best rates. For your return to Rochester, you’ll find the best rates on Mondays and the most expensive ones on Saturdays.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Rochester to Myrtle Beach?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ights from Rochester to Myrtle Beach,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.
The cheapest month for flights from Rochester to Myrtle Beach is August, where tickets cost $180 on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are March and April, where the average cost of tickets is $472 and $424 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Rochester to Myrtle Beach?

To calculate daily average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each day before departure over the last year for flights from Rochester to Myrtle Beach,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each month.
To get a below average price on the flight from Rochester to Myrtle Beach, you should book around 5 days before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 33 days before departure.

Which airlines fly non-stop between Rochester and Myrtle Beach?

Airline and price data is aggregated from results in KAYAK’s search results from the last 2 weeks for flights from Rochester to Myrtle Beach.
There is just one airline that flies from Rochester to Myrtle Beach direct and that is Spirit Airlines. The best one-way deal found from Spirit Airlines for the route is $65.

How many flights are there between Rochester and Myrtle Beach per day?

There is a maximum of 1 nonstop flight a day that takes off from Rochester and lands in Myrtle Beach, with an average flight time of 2h 02m. The most common departure time is 10:00 am and most flights take off in the morning. Each week, there are 4 flights.

Which cabin class options are there for flights between Rochester and Myrtle Beach?

The average price of flights for each cabin class for the route found by users searching on KAYAK over the last 2 weeks.
There is only one cabin class option available for the route, which is Economy. Perform a search on KAYAK to find the latest prices and availability for all cabin fares, which differ across airlines.

How long does a flight from Rochester to Myrtle Beach take?

The duration of a nonstop flight to Myrtle Beach from Rochester is typically 1h 52m. The journey crosses a distance of 655 miles.

What’s the earliest departure time from Rochester to Myrtle Beach?

Early birds can take the earliest flight from Rochester at 10:20 am and will be landing in Myrtle Beach at 12:22 pm.

What’s the latest departure time from Rochester to Myrtle Beach?

If you prefer to fly at night, the latest flight from Rochester to Myrtle Beach jets off at 5:15 pm and lands at 7:19 pm.

FAQs for booking flights from Rochester to Myrtle Beach

  • What is the cheapest flight from Rochester to Myrtle Beach?

    In the last 3 days, the lowest price for a flight from Rochester to Myrtle Beach was $39 for a one-way ticket and $78 for a round-trip.

  • Do I need a passport to fly between Rochester and Myrtle Beach?

    No, a passport isn't needed to fly from Rochester to Myrtle Beach. However, local authorities might ask for an official ID.

  • Which airports will I be using when flying from Rochester to Myrtle Beach?

    Rochester airport is called Rochester Greater Rochester Intl and the only airport in Myrtle Beach is Myrtle Beach Intl.

  • Which airlines offer Wi-Fi service onboard planes from Rochester to Myrtle Beach?

    Only JetBlue offers inflight Wi-Fi service on the Rochester to Myrtle Beach flight route.

  • Which aircraft models fly most regularly from Rochester to Myrtle Beach?

    The Airbus A320 (sharklets) is the aircraft model that flies most regularly on the Rochester to Myrtle Beach flight route.

  • On which days can I fly direct from Rochester to Myrtle Beach?

    You can catch a nonstop flight from Rochester to Myrtle Beach on on Monday, Wednesday, Friday, and Saturday.

  • Which is the best airline for flights from Rochester to Myrtle Beach, Delta or American Airlines?

    The two airlines most popular with KAYAK users for flights from Rochester to Myrtle Beach are Delta and American Airlines. With an average price for the route of $386 and an overall rating of 8.0, Delta is the most popular choice. American Airlines is also a great choice for the route, with an average price of $395 and an overall rating of 7.3.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Rochester to Myrtle Beach?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Myrtle Beach with an airline and back to Rochester with another airline. Booking your flights between Rochester and MYR can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
